A new Eurobarometer survey uncovered some moderately disturbing insights. First and foremost, that around 10% of all European web clients had encountered online extortion as well as data fraud in some structure, and that 74% of those tested accepted digital wrongdoing to be an 'expanding hazard'. Also, that just barely more than half had some type of hostile to infection programming introduced on their PCs, and that 57% would open messages from addresses they didn't perceive. McAffe, in a different report, has as of late distributed a rundown of what it considers to be the preeminent internet based dangers in the coming year. Among the dangers, it makes reference to workers of organizations being focused on as 'entryways' past security and further developed infections intended to take banking data.
